Chapter 37- From hunter to prey.
"GWAAAaaaKk!"
Bolting upright in panic, I frantically look around for the source of the high-pitched screech that awoke me from my slumber, only to realize that it is still in the middle of the night and there is virtually no light to speak of. Short story shorter: I can't see jack shit in the darkness.
Trying to calm my frantically beating heart, I try to silence my breathing as much as I can and begin to listen for the source of the sound to see if I can locate it better.
A few seconds of silence follows before I start being able to pick up footsteps coming from the forest floor below. At first they seem faint, barely perceptible, but I soon realize that the thing simply is far away as the footfalls get progressively heavier and louder as the thing gets closer to me.
As this thing comes ever closer I am even starting to be able to feel the vibrations that the heavy footfalls are causing.
'How damn big and heavy is this thing?!' I mentally exclaim as the thing coming ever closer is starting to really fray my nerves.
Suddenly, as the vibrations and the sound from the heavy things footfalls reach a peak, the footfalls stop and a moment of silence follows.
"Gwwaaak!? Gwaaak?" The thing screeches before once again going quiet for a long moment. "… Ggwakk!"
With a deafening boom, the tree, and consequently the tree branch and the vines attached to said branch where I currently lie, start shaking violently as the vibrations travel up through and spread out throughout the gigantic tree.
"Holy-!" I exclaim in surprise as I grab onto the vines to keep from falling down through holes in the vine net which I was sleeping on.
The vibrations continue on for another few seconds but most of the vibrations potency is lost in the first second or so as the remaining vibration almost sets the tree to a low tone hum which quickly peters out as the still and quiet night reclaims the world.
"Gwak?" Comes a squeak from down below and a moment later I start hearing the heavy footfalls once again, this time moving away from the tree I am currently in and away towards where I assume I came from as the thing seems to be following my trail, somehow. It doesn't seem to be tracking me by smell, as if that was the case, the thing would know that I am up here as the smell should be strongest where I currently am.
Advertisement
…? 'Is it somehow tracking me by the trail of my magic? Or is it something different which I haven't thought about? … At least whatever it is using doesn't seem to be all that effective at pinpointing my current location, or I would've been in big trouble right about now.' I muse as I listen carefully to the retreating footfalls as they get further and further away. '… Or am I just not worth the trouble and it gave up and went home? … Yeah, I dunno. At least it's going away now, and that's all I really care about at the moment.' I conclude as I let myself relax a little more as I become unable to pick up the heavy footfalls from the heavy creature anymore.
Breathing a sigh of relief, I slump back down on the vine net and look up into the complete darkness above me.
"I really need to get the hell out of this god-damned place…" I mutter tiredly to myself before I close my eyes and try to fall asleep.
Sleep does not come easily however, as I toss and turn for a long time: I don't know if it is an hour or a few hours, but the time passes excruciatingly slowly; Yet before I know it, I get shocked awake and the light burns my tired and unadjusted eyes. Wincing from the uncomfortableness, I squint my eyes and look around slowly.
"So I fell asleep somewhere along the way, huh… Damn my eyes sting." I mutter tiredly as I force my tired body up into a sitting position before I sigh and start making my way over to the tree branch proper to start stretching out the kinks from my body. "Tonight sucked like a fox. It feels like I haven't slept any at all...
What the hell was that anyway?" I muse aloud as I continue stretching my tired body.
After I finish stretching, I sit down and start breathing deeply as I meditate for a while to try and clear out some of the tiredness from my body; About half an hour later I open my eyes and stand up before I walk over to the edge of the branch to look down, just to check that there aren't any monsters lying in wait for me down there.
Advertisement
After a few minutes of carefully surveying the area, I take a deep breath before I walk off of the branch and start falling head first towards the forest floor some 30 meters below.
As I free fall towards the forest floor I survey the area for a place to Blink to, and as I pass the 10 meter mark from the forest floor, I prepare to execute the skill. As I reach about 5 meters above ground I disappear and reappear 40 meters away on a big boulder that lets me see a decent distance in all directions of the woodland.
"Now which way should I go…?" I ask out loud as I look around for any landmark that I may remember.
Sadly, it all looks like the same old woodland landscape to me no matter which direction I look, so I can only sigh and start walking in the direction where I sense the lowest concentration Mana is. "This is going to be one lo~ng and tiresome day, isn't it?" I mumble tiredly to myself as I walk along while keeping a constant watchful eye on my surroundings, in case any unwanted surprises come along.
--------
A few hours until my return trek, I find a stream of water where I promptly quench my thirst before refilling all of my water-skins. I decided to make a campsite a decent distance from the stream, where I can prepare my breakfast. Once I catch said breakfast, that is. Which is the next order of things: I go hunting for sustenance, be it meat or anything else.
Setting out along the stream, I make my way downstream as I keep a close eye out for anything editable.
Seconds turn into minutes and minutes turn into an hour and yet I still haven't been able to find anything which I would consider editable.
Another half hour passes before I hear a loud howl from somewhere deep within the woodland, the howl's echo continues spreading out and comes at me from a number of different directions, which leaves me utterly unable to pinpoint where the sound originated from.
As the loud howl's echo dies down, a moment of silence and stillness follows and I take in a deep breath. 'C'mon! Please!' I pray in my mind as I hold my breath.
But the silence is broken by a multitude of loud howl's echoing throughout the woodlands from all around me.
"Fuck my life!" I exclaim as I start running as I look around for an open branch or the like where I can take shelter while being able to attack from a distance. After a minute of running, I notice a large and tall boulder that stands easily 20 meters tall and promptly decide on using it as it should be quite hard to scale while also giving me the high ground.
As I continue running towards the large boulder, I start hearing footfalls coming from behind me which redoubles my efforts to hurry the hell up and get up onto the boulder.
As I cross the 50 meters mark, I immediately Blink up onto the giant boulder and start sweeping my gaze around the edges of the gigantic rock to see how many wolf's there are that I have to deal with and immediately draw back in shock as I take in the dozens upon dozens of gigantic wolf's that are rushing towards me.
"Fucking great! I go searching for food and suddenly I am the one being hunted. Fuck this god-forsaken forest and everything in it!" I exclaim in anger as I take a iai stance and do a sword draw that sends a wind-blade flying into the mass of incoming giant beasts.
While dozens die to the wind-blade, there are dozens upon dozens more that quickly take their place as they continue rushing towards me.
"If only I could use the wind-blade in quick succession…" I mutter as I begin gathering and condensing Mana to cast a chain lighting spell on the wolf pack, only to stop short and have to dodge as a particularly big wolf suddenly appears out of nowhere and lunges at me with open maw and claws poised to grab and hold me in place.
"Shi-!"
